Senator Martin Heinrich (D-NM) seeks an Appropriations Aide based in Washington, DC. This position is responsible for identifying and executing initiatives to increase resources and solve problems in New Mexico by liaising with federal, state, and local agencies, and other persons, entities or groups to form effective relationships for the Senator and maximize the resources available to New Mexico. Responsibilities:
Responsibilities involve assisting with Appropriations Committee work, including Congressionally Directed Spending requests, tracking federal grants and awards relevant to constituents, and identifying and researching opportunities to support the New Mexican economy. This position is required to work in the office.
Qualifications:
Ideal candidates will have knowledge of the legislative appropriations process, have outstanding written and oral communication skills, be service- and solutions-oriented, be highly organized, and take an innovative and collaborative approach with community and colleagues. Ties to New Mexico, fluency in Spanish, and familiarity with rural communities and Tribal governments are a significant plus.
